Not even in front of Effects was able to Panathinaikos!
The “greens” in a frozen climate due to the tragedy in Tempi gave the right to the Turkish team to leave with the “double” from OAKA (82-87), staying away from the pink leaves for the fifth consecutive game and falling to 8 -18 in the Euroleague.
THE Panathinaikos he was for the most part of the match behind the score, he was even at -16 and only at the end he managed to get some reaction, without really claiming the victory.
It was not, however, all bad for Christos Serelis’ team, which saw Marius Grigonis play a key role and make his best performance in green, scoring 23 points on 5/7 three-pointers. From then on, Lee who fought until the end had 19 points, while 8 had o Thomas which made a good first part.
For Efes, which rose to 13-13 and continues the hunt for the top eight, it was improbable with 24 points Will Clyburnwhile Bryant had 16, Larkin 13 and 12 with 7 rebounds Zizic.
The match
The two teams started by going point-to-point in the first few minutes, with Ponitka, Kalaitzakis on the one hand and Clyburn, Zizic on the other hand, to make it 8-6, before the Pole wrote 11-8. The match was very slow at this point, and Zizic responded with four points of his own for 11-12, while Grigonis made it 14-12 with a 3-pointer, with Clyburn immediately making it 14-15. The two teams continued hand in hand until the end of the quarter (21-18).
With the start of the second period, Clyburn and Manzoukas traded 3-pointers for 24-21, before a red-hot Grigonis made it 27-23 and Thomas the 32-25. Clyburn and Bryant responded, cutting it to 34-30 for the Turks, who continued to find solutions with Larkin to bring them ahead of the score (34-36). THE Matt Thomas immediately regained Panathinaikos’ lead with a three-pointer (37-36) and two shots (39-36). However, Ataman’s team again responded, closing the half in front thanks to Larkin and Zizic (40-43).
With the good morning of the third period, o Clyburn picked up where he left off and made it 40-46 with a three-pointer before Bryant made it 40-49. The situation became even more difficult for the blocked Panathinaikos, with the Bryant again to make a very difficult three-pointer for the +11 of the Turks (43-54). Panathinaikos found a reaction with Grigonis and Papagianni, down to 8 (48-56), before Lee made a three-pointer for 51-56 and a foul shot for 54-56. Efes recovered +8 with Bobois and Plays (54-62), with the third period ending at 54-64.
At the start of the fourth quarter, a three-pointer of his Singleton brought Ephesus to +13 (54-67) for the first time, before Larkin also brought it to +15 (57-72). The gap slipped even further when Bryant posted a 60-76. Panathinaikos with three points from Lee and Grigonis but also his layup Manjuka dropped to 8 (69-77), closing the gap to 6 with Lee (73-79). Nevertheless, a big basket by Larkin made it 73-81 and somewhere there the match ended, which had a final score of 82-87.
The quarters: 21-18, 40-43, 54-64, 82-87
